Research On Copper-molybdenum Ore Flotation Separation Process

Most copper-molybdenum ores adopt the mixed flotation-copper-molybdenum separation process, because molybdenite and chalcopyrite have similar floatability and serious concomitant, and this process has lower cost and simpler process. In general, the mixed collectors of flotation machine use xanthate (butyl xanthate), auxiliary collector hydrocarbon oil …

Chromium Ore Dressing Process Gravity Separation- Henan KaiYun

Introduction Chromium ore dressing process is mainly a gravity separation process, which is a method of separating minerals according to different mineral densities. The equipment used includes jigs, shaking tables, spiral polarizers, centrifugal concentrators and spiral chutes. Sometimes, the gravity separation concentrate also needs to be re-selected with …

Dense Media Separation

In a Dense Media Separation (DMS) plant, powdered ferrosilicon (an alloy of iron and silicone) is suspended in water to form a fluid near the density of diamond (3.52 g/cm3), to which the diamond bearing material is added to begin the separation process of the heavier minerals from the lighter material.
